Core Insights - RedCloud Holdings aims to address the $2 trillion global inventory gap in the Fast Moving Consumer Goods (FMCG) sector through its AI-powered trading platform, RedAI [1][6]. Company Developments - CEO Justin Floyd will participate in two major U.S. investor conferences in November 2025, including the 14th Annual Roth Technology Conference and the Clear Street Disruptive Technology Conference [2][3]. - Recent strategic announcements include a joint venture in Saudi Arabia and the launch of RedCloud Arabia, showcasing the company's scalable global expansion model [2][5]. Market Position and Strategy - RedCloud has more than doubled its customer base year-over-year in the first half of 2025 and is actively engaged in the NVIDIA Connect program to enhance its AI capabilities [5]. - The company is focused on deploying native-AI infrastructure from NVIDIA and AWS to innovate and tackle the FMCG inventory challenge, which is critical for improving supply chain performance [6][7]. Technology and Innovation - The RedAI platform facilitates the exchange of digitized FMCG inventory, providing data-driven market insights to streamline B2B purchases and inventory decisions [7][8]. - The platform aims to solve long-standing issues in supply chain trade by aggregating market and inventory data from brands, distributors, and retailers [7].
